Jo Condrill is an award-winning speaker,
author, and consultant. She had a
distinguished career in leadership positions
with the US Army where she served as Deputy
Chief of the Logistics Plans and Operations
Division in the Pentagon. She was awarded
the highest honor the Army can bestow on a
civilian, the Decoration for Exceptional
Civilian Service. Among numerous
demonstrations of acting upon what she
teaches, Jo also led 3000 Washington, DC,
Toastmasters to a first-ever #1 ranking
worldwide. She later served on their Board
of Directors. Jo presents keynote speeches
and seminars on communication and leadership
skills internationally. She is active in
Rotary International, Toastmasters
International, and the National Speakers
Association.
